The Many Dangers Of Artificial Food Dye




You are supposed to eat the rainbow right? Well the answer is yes and no. Eating an array of colors generally is extremely beneficial for your health. Typically a colorful diet means loads of vitmains, minerals, fiber and antioxidant. BUT the kicker is these colors must only come from natural sources period. Artificial food coloring of any kind is extremely harmful to one's health yet unfortunately it is so commonly used and consumed. So let's break down some of the most commonly used and consumed food dyes:


  1. Red 40: linked to several forms of cancer, ADHD and hyperactive mannerisms and mood disorders

  2. Red 3: linked to thyroid cancer specifically

  3. Red 2: linked to bladder tumors

  4. Yellow 5: linked to hyperactivity in children

  5. Yellow 6: possibly linked to adrenal tumors

  6. Blue 1: linked to kidney tumors and asthma

  7. Blue 2: possibly linked to brain tumors


...as you can see artificial food coloring doesn't do any one of us any favors! So, clearly it is in our best interest to avoid them and find a healthy alternative.
